2021 Honda Pilot Reviews Summary

It’s been seven years since Honda last redesigned the Pilot, the automaker’s popular midsize three-row crossover SUV. In most ways, age has been kind to it, but to love a 2021 Honda Pilot you must first live with one. Unlike some competitors, the styling is not a strong suit. Rather, it is the Pilot’s interior, powertrain, driving dynamics, and simple but useful technology that makes you appreciate it each and every day. Well, that, and the cheap lease payment.

2021 Jeep Wrangler 4xe Reviews Summary

It’s 2021, which means automakers are electrifying everything under the sun, from family crossovers to pickup trucks and minivans. This list now includes one of the most legendary off-roaders of all time, the Jeep Wrangler, which sees the 4xe plug-in hybrid join the line-up for the 2021 model year. Long-time Wrangler owners may be encountering electrification for the first time, which could lead them to wondering if a plug-in hybrid Jeep is as capable as any other. In a word: yes.

Look and feel

2021 Honda Pilot

7/10

2021 Jeep Wrangler 4xe

7/10

The 2021 Honda Pilot aimed to balance rugged styling with practicality, following a 2019 refresh and the introduction of the Black Edition in 2020. Despite these efforts, its exterior design remained polarizing. The Pilot was available in five trims in Canada, all featuring standard all-wheel drive. The Black Edition, which we tested, came fully loaded with exclusive black leather upholstery and red accents, though its black mats were notorious for attracting pet hair. The interior quality was commendable, with a minivan-like front seat experience due to its flat dashboard and low centre console, which some found unappealing.

In contrast, the 2021 Jeep Wrangler 4xe retained its iconic Wrangler styling, with only subtle hints of its plug-in hybrid nature, such as blue decals and a charging port. The Wrangler's interior quality was consistent across its three grades, with the Unlimited Rubicon offering optional leather seats and a Cold Weather Group for added comfort. The Wrangler's interior featured a mix of leather and black plastic, with a distinctive grab handle for the front passenger. Despite its hybrid nature, the Wrangler maintained its rugged appeal, though some quirks, like the centre stack window controls, persisted.

Performance

2021 Honda Pilot

8/10

2021 Jeep Wrangler 4xe

9/10

The 2021 Honda Pilot was powered by a 3.5-litre V6 engine, delivering 280 horsepower and 262 pound-feet of torque. This engine, paired with a nine-speed automatic transmission and torque-vectoring all-wheel-drive system, provided a smooth and responsive driving experience. The Pilot's fuel efficiency was rated at 11.0 litres per 100 kilometres in combined driving, with our test vehicle achieving 10.9 L/100 km. Its suspension system offered a comfortable ride and surprisingly agile handling, though its off-road capabilities were limited by modest ground clearance and approach angles.

The 2021 Jeep Wrangler 4xe combined a 2.0-litre turbocharged four-cylinder engine with electric motors, producing a total of 375 horsepower and 470 pound-feet of torque. This setup, paired with an eight-speed automatic transmission, offered impressive off-road capabilities, including a Rock-trac transfer case, solid axles, and up to 76 cm of water fording capability. The Wrangler 4xe's plug-in hybrid system provided an electric-only range of 35 kilometres, with various modes to optimize battery usage. While the Wrangler 4xe delivered a burst of energy from a stop, it wasn't the quietest or best-handling vehicle for everyday driving.

Form and function

2021 Honda Pilot

9/10

2021 Jeep Wrangler 4xe

8/10

The 2021 Honda Pilot offered ample space for families, with seating for up to eight people. The Black Edition featured comfortable leather-wrapped, heated, and ventilated front seats, though the front passenger seat had limited adjustment options. Second-row captain's chairs were standard on the Black Edition, providing comfort and easy access to the third row. The Pilot's cargo space was generous, with 524 litres behind the third row and up to 3,092 litres with all seats folded. Storage solutions were abundant, with compartments throughout the cabin.

The 2021 Jeep Wrangler 4xe was designed to accommodate its battery pack without sacrificing interior space. The Wrangler's headroom and legroom were only slightly compromised, and the Rubicon's soft-top roof offered additional headroom. Cargo space was slightly reduced compared to non-hybrid Wranglers, with 784 litres available with the second-row seats upright and 1,908 litres with them folded. The Wrangler's compact dimensions made it manageable in urban settings, and the optional power-retracting roof added convenience for open-air driving.

Technology

2021 Honda Pilot

5/10

2021 Jeep Wrangler 4xe

7/10

The 2021 Honda Pilot featured an 8-inch touchscreen infotainment system with Bluetooth, Apple CarPlay, and Android Auto. Higher trims offered additional features like a built-in navigation system, wireless phone charging, and a premium audio system. The Touring trim added a rear-seat entertainment system and Cabin Talk feature. While the infotainment system was adequate, it lacked some modern conveniences, such as a tuning knob and advanced voice recognition.

The 2021 Jeep Wrangler 4xe came with Uconnect 4C on an 8.4-inch touchscreen, offering Android Auto and Apple CarPlay. Uconnect was praised for its intuitive interface, with hard buttons and dials for essential functions. The Wrangler included off-road and Hybrid Electric Pages for monitoring vehicle performance. However, it lacked some advanced tech features, such as a fully digital instrument cluster and wireless phone charging, which were surprising omissions for a vehicle in its price range.

Safety

2021 Honda Pilot

7/10

2021 Jeep Wrangler 4xe

3/10

The 2021 Honda Pilot came standard with Honda Sensing, a suite of advanced driving assistance systems, including adaptive cruise control, forward-collision warning, and lane-keeping assist. The Pilot received favourable crash-test ratings, with a five-star overall rating from the NHTSA and high marks from the IIHS, though some areas received lower scores.

The 2021 Jeep Wrangler 4xe shared its safety ratings with other Wrangler models. It received Good ratings in most crashworthiness tests from the IIHS, but some areas, like the driver's side small overlap front test, were rated Marginal. The Wrangler's safety features were limited, with optional packages available for additional assistance systems.
